Python脚本输出特定的数据XML

时间:2015-10-02 12:55:06

标签: python xml

我有一个大型XML文件,我将其用作主数据库。我需要能够输入python脚本要求我的特定标题,该标题将通过XML文件并仅将与该标题关联的数据输出到新的XML文件中。我真的很难在哪里开始,所以如果有人有任何阅读材料让我开始,我将不胜感激

1 个答案:

答案 0 :(得分:0)

也许是那样的

import xml.dom.minidom
key = raw_input('header ?') # input
bdFile = xml.dom.minidom.parse("/tmp/toto.xml") # parse xml
node = bdFile.getElementsByTagName(key)[0] # search
# write
resultFile = open("/tmp/destination.xml", 'w') 
resultFile.write(node.toxml())
resultFile.close()